WaitLess App
We are aware that a lot of parents/guardians are struggling to get doctor's appointments so we wanted to share this app that is proving useful to get walk-in and emergency appointments.
The WaitLess app is a free mobile application designed to help patients find the least busy urgent care facilities and reduce their waiting times. It provides real-time information on waiting times, queue numbers, and travel times to various urgent care centers, allowing patients to make informed decisions about where to seek treatment. The app also offers information on available pharmacies and other non-emergency treatment options.

Year 9 MYP Awards Evening
Our Year 9 MYP Awards Evening was a fantastic celebration of the hard work, growth, and achievements of our students throughout the academic year. The evening was made even more special by the involvement of our talented Year 10 catering students, who prepared and served a delicious selection of hors d'oeuvres and refreshments, showcasing their culinary skills with professionalism and flair.
Guests were also treated to an inspiring talk by local entrepreneur Thomas Mudge, co-founder of Beer and Feast, who shared insights into his journey and encouraged students to pursue their passions with confidence and creativity.
Adding to the atmosphere, two of our Year 10 music students gave outstanding performances, providing a brilliant musical backdrop to the evening and highlighting the diverse talents across our academy.
The event was a wonderful reflection of the spirit and success of our MYP curriculum and life at Leigh Academy Rainham- an evening full of pride, inspiration, and community.
